diff --git a/package.json b/package.json index 1b368b2f..ed59cb49 100644 --- a/package.json +++ b/package.json @@ -77,7 +77,7 @@ "unplugin-purge-polyfills": "^0.0.7", "unws": "^0.2.4", "vitest": "^2.1.8", - "vue-tsc": "^2.1.10", + "vue-tsc": "^2.2.0", "ws": "^8.18.0" }, "resolutions": { di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 909ff428..f8ebe369 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-96,7 +96,7 @@ importers: version: 1.7.3 nuxt: specifier: ^3.14.1592 - version: 3.14.1592(@parcel/watcher@2.4.1)(@types/node@22.10.2)(encoding@0.1.13)(eslint@9.17.0(jiti@2.4.2))(ioredis@5.4.1)(magicast@0.3.5)(optionator@0.9.3)(rollup@4.28.1)(terser@5.29.2)(typescript@5.4.2)(vite@5.4.11(@types/node@22.10.2)(terser@5.29.2))(vue-tsc@2.1.10(typescript@5.4.2)) + version: 3.14.1592(@parcel/watcher@2.4.1)(@types/node@22.10.2)(encoding@0.1.13)(eslint@9.17.0(jiti@2.4.2))(ioredis@5.4.1)(magicast@0.3.5)(optionator@0.9.3)(rollup@4.28.1)(terser@5.29.2)(typescript@5.4.2)(vite@5.4.11(@types/node@22.10.2)(terser@5.29.2))(vue-tsc@2.2.0(typescript@5.4.2)) nypm: specifier: ^0.4.1 version: 0.4.1 @@ -120,7 +120,7 @@ importers: version: 7.6.3 unbuild: specifier: ^3.0.1 - version: 3.0.1(typescript@5.4.2)(vue-tsc@2.1.10(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2)) + version: 3.0.1(typescript@5.4.2)(vue-tsc@2.2.0(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2)) unplugin-purge-polyfills: specifier: ^0.0.7 version: 0.0.7(rollup@4.28.1) @@ -131,8 +131,8 @@ importers: specifier: ^2.1.8 version: 2.1.8(@types/node@22.10.2)(terser@5.29.2) vue-tsc: - specifier: ^2.1.10 - version: 2.1.10(typescript@5.4.2) + specifier: ^2.2.0 + version: 2.2.0(typescript@5.4.2) ws: specifier: ^8.18.0 version: 8.18.0 @@ -1315,14 +1315,14 @@ packages: '@vitest/utils@2.1.8': resolution: {integrity: sha512-dwSoui6djdwbfFmIgbIjX2ZhIoG7Ex/+xpxyiEgIGzjliY8xGkcpITKTlp6B4MgtGkF2ilvm97cPM96XZaAgcA==} - '@volar/language-core@2.4.8': - resolution: {integrity: sha512-K/GxMOXGq997bO00cdFhTNuR85xPxj0BEEAy+BaqqayTmy9Tmhfgmq2wpJcVspRhcwfgPoE2/mEJa26emUhG/g==} + '@volar/language-core@2.4.11': + resolution: {integrity: sha512-lN2C1+ByfW9/JRPpqScuZt/4OrUUse57GLI6TbLgTIqBVemdl1wNcZ1qYGEo2+Gw8coYLgCy7SuKqn6IrQcQgg==} - '@volar/source-map@2.4.8': - resolution: {integrity: sha512-jeWJBkC/WivdelMwxKkpFL811uH/jJ1kVxa+c7OvG48DXc3VrP7pplSWPP2W1dLMqBxD+awRlg55FQQfiup4cA==} + '@volar/source-map@2.4.11': + resolution: {integrity: sha512-ZQpmafIGvaZMn/8iuvCFGrW3smeqkq/IIh9F1SdSx9aUl0J4Iurzd6/FhmjNO5g2ejF3rT45dKskgXWiofqlZQ==} - '@volar/typescript@2.4.8': - resolution: {integrity: sha512-6xkIYJ5xxghVBhVywMoPMidDDAFT1OoQeXwa27HSgJ6AiIKRe61RXLoik+14Z7r0JvnblXVsjsRLmCr42SGzqg==} + '@volar/typescript@2.4.11': + resolution: {integrity: sha512-2DT+Tdh88Spp5PyPbqhyoYavYCPDsqbHLFwcUI9K1NlY1YgUJvujGdrqUp0zWxnW7KWNTr3xSpMuv2WnaTKDAw==} '@vue-macros/common@1.12.2': resolution: {integrity: sha512-+NGfhrPvPNOb3Wg9PNPEXPe0HTXmVe6XJawL1gi3cIjOSGIhpOdvmMT2cRuWb265IpA/PeL5Sqo0+DQnEDxLvw==} @@ -1378,8 +1378,8 @@ packages: '@vue/devtools-shared@7.4.5': resolution: {integrity: sha512-2XgUOkL/7QDmyYI9J7cm+rz/qBhcGv+W5+i1fhwdQ0HQ1RowhdK66F0QBuJSz/5k12opJY8eN6m03/XZMs7imQ==} - '@vue/language-core@2.1.10': - resolution: {integrity: sha512-DAI289d0K3AB5TUG3xDp9OuQ71CnrujQwJrQnfuZDwo6eGNf0UoRlPuaVNO+Zrn65PC3j0oB2i7mNmVPggeGeQ==} + '@vue/language-core@2.2.0': + resolution: {integrity: sha512-O1ZZFaaBGkKbsRfnVH1ifOK1/1BUkyK+3SQsfnh6PmMmD4qJcTU8godCeA96jjDRTL6zgnK7YzCHfaUlH2r0Mw==} peerDependencies: typescript: '*' peerDependenciesMeta: @@ -1433,8 +1433,8 @@ packages: ajv@6.12.6: resolution: {integrity: sha512-j3fVLgvTo527anyYyJOGTYJbG+vnnQYvE0m5mmkc1TK+nxAppkCLMIL0aZ4dblVCNoGShhm+kzE4ZUykBoMg4g==} - alien-signals@0.2.0: - resolution: {integrity: sha512-StlonZhBBrsPPwrDjiPAiVTf/rolxffLxVPT60Qv/t88BZ81BvUVzHgGqEFvJ1ii8HXtm1+zU2Icr59tfWEcag==} + alien-signals@0.4.9: + resolution: {integrity: sha512-piRGlMgQ65uRiY06mGU7I432AwPwAGf64TK1RXtM1Px4pPfLMTGI9TmsHTfioW1GukZRsNzkVQ/uHjhhd231Ow==} ansi-colors@4.1.3: resolution: {integrity: sha512-/6w/C21Pm1A7aZitlI5Ni/2J6FFQN8i1Cvz3kHABAAbw93v/NlvKdVOqz7CCWz/3iv/JplRSEEZ83XION15ovw==} @@ -4177,8 +4177,8 @@ packages: peerDependencies: vue: ^3.2.0 - vue-tsc@2.1.10: - resolution: {integrity: sha512-RBNSfaaRHcN5uqVqJSZh++Gy/YUzryuv9u1aFWhsammDJXNtUiJMNoJ747lZcQ68wUQFx6E73y4FY3D8E7FGMA==} + vue-tsc@2.2.0: + resolution: {integrity: sha512-gtmM1sUuJ8aSb0KoAFmK9yMxb8TxjewmxqTJ1aKphD5Cbu0rULFY6+UQT51zW7SpUcenfPUuflKyVwyx9Qdnxg==} hasBin: true peerDependencies: typescript: '>=5.0.0' @@ -5028,7 +5028,7 @@ snapshots: - terser - typescript - '@nuxt/vite-builder@3.14.1592(@types/node@22.10.2)(eslint@9.17.0(jiti@2.4.2))(magicast@0.3.5)(optionator@0.9.3)(rollup@4.28.1)(terser@5.29.2)(typescript@5.4.2)(vue-tsc@2.1.10(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2))': + '@nuxt/vite-builder@3.14.1592(@types/node@22.10.2)(eslint@9.17.0(jiti@2.4.2))(magicast@0.3.5)(optionator@0.9.3)(rollup@4.28.1)(terser@5.29.2)(typescript@5.4.2)(vue-tsc@2.2.0(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2))': dependencies: '@nuxt/kit': 3.14.1592(magicast@0.3.5)(rollup@4.28.1) '@rollup/plugin-replace': 6.0.1(rollup@4.28.1) @@ -5062,7 +5062,7 @@ snapshots: unplugin: 1.16.0 vite: 5.4.11(@types/node@22.10.2)(terser@5.29.2) vite-node: 2.1.8(@types/node@22.10.2)(terser@5.29.2) - vite-plugin-checker: 0.8.0(eslint@9.17.0(jiti@2.4.2))(optionator@0.9.3)(typescript@5.4.2)(vite@5.4.11(@types/node@22.10.2)(terser@5.29.2))(vue-tsc@2.1.10(typescript@5.4.2)) + vite-plugin-checker: 0.8.0(eslint@9.17.0(jiti@2.4.2))(optionator@0.9.3)(typescript@5.4.2)(vite@5.4.11(@types/node@22.10.2)(terser@5.29.2))(vue-tsc@2.2.0(typescript@5.4.2)) vue: 3.5.13(typescript@5.4.2) vue-bundle-renderer: 2.1.1 transitivePeerDependencies: @@ -5616,15 +5616,15 @@ snapshots: loupe: 3.1.2 tinyrainbow: 1.2.0 - '@volar/language-core@2.4.8': + '@volar/language-core@2.4.11': dependencies: - '@volar/source-map': 2.4.8 + '@volar/source-map': 2.4.11 - '@volar/source-map@2.4.8': {} + '@volar/source-map@2.4.11': {} - '@volar/typescript@2.4.8': + '@volar/typescript@2.4.11': dependencies: - '@volar/language-core': 2.4.8 + '@volar/language-core': 2.4.11 path-browserify: 1.0.1 vscode-uri: 3.0.8 @@ -5734,13 +5734,13 @@ snapshots: dependencies: rfdc: 1.4.1 - '@vue/language-core@2.1.10(typescript@5.4.2)': + '@vue/language-core@2.2.0(typescript@5.4.2)': dependencies: - '@volar/language-core': 2.4.8 + '@volar/language-core': 2.4.11 '@vue/compiler-dom': 3.5.13 '@vue/compiler-vue2': 2.7.16 '@vue/shared': 3.5.13 - alien-signals: 0.2.0 + alien-signals: 0.4.9 minimatch: 9.0.4 muggle-string: 0.4.1 path-browserify: 1.0.1 @@ -5796,7 +5796,7 @@ snapshots: json-schema-traverse: 0.4.1 uri-js: 4.4.1 - alien-signals@0.2.0: {} + alien-signals@0.4.9: {} ansi-colors@4.1.3: {} @@ -7253,7 +7253,7 @@ snapshots: mkdirp@3.0.1: {} - mkdist@2.0.1(typescript@5.4.2)(vue-tsc@2.1.10(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2)): + mkdist@2.0.1(typescript@5.4.2)(vue-tsc@2.2.0(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2)): dependencies: autoprefixer: 10.4.20(postcss@8.4.49) citty: 0.1.6 @@ -7271,7 +7271,7 @@ snapshots: optionalDependencies: typescript: 5.4.2 vue: 3.5.13(typescript@5.4.2) - vue-tsc: 2.1.10(typescript@5.4.2) + vue-tsc: 2.2.0(typescript@5.4.2) mlly@1.7.3: dependencies: @@ -7444,14 +7444,14 @@ snapshots: nuxi@3.15.0: {} - nuxt@3.14.1592(@parcel/watcher@2.4.1)(@types/node@22.10.2)(encoding@0.1.13)(eslint@9.17.0(jiti@2.4.2))(ioredis@5.4.1)(magicast@0.3.5)(optionator@0.9.3)(rollup@4.28.1)(terser@5.29.2)(typescript@5.4.2)(vite@5.4.11(@types/node@22.10.2)(terser@5.29.2))(vue-tsc@2.1.10(typescript@5.4.2)): + nuxt@3.14.1592(@parcel/watcher@2.4.1)(@types/node@22.10.2)(encoding@0.1.13)(eslint@9.17.0(jiti@2.4.2))(ioredis@5.4.1)(magicast@0.3.5)(optionator@0.9.3)(rollup@4.28.1)(terser@5.29.2)(typescript@5.4.2)(vite@5.4.11(@types/node@22.10.2)(terser@5.29.2))(vue-tsc@2.2.0(typescript@5.4.2)): dependencies: '@nuxt/devalue': 2.0.2 '@nuxt/devtools': 1.6.0(rollup@4.28.1)(vite@5.4.11(@types/node@22.10.2)(terser@5.29.2))(vue@3.5.13(typescript@5.4.2)) '@nuxt/kit': 3.14.1592(magicast@0.3.5)(rollup@4.28.1) '@nuxt/schema': 3.14.1592(magicast@0.3.5)(rollup@4.28.1) '@nuxt/telemetry': 2.6.0(magicast@0.3.5)(rollup@4.28.1) - '@nuxt/vite-builder': 3.14.1592(@types/node@22.10.2)(eslint@9.17.0(jiti@2.4.2))(magicast@0.3.5)(optionator@0.9.3)(rollup@4.28.1)(terser@5.29.2)(typescript@5.4.2)(vue-tsc@2.1.10(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2)) + '@nuxt/vite-builder': 3.14.1592(@types/node@22.10.2)(eslint@9.17.0(jiti@2.4.2))(magicast@0.3.5)(optionator@0.9.3)(rollup@4.28.1)(terser@5.29.2)(typescript@5.4.2)(vue-tsc@2.2.0(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2)) '@unhead/dom': 1.11.11 '@unhead/shared': 1.11.11 '@unhead/ssr': 1.11.11 @@ -8389,7 +8389,7 @@ snapshots: ultrahtml@1.5.3: {} - unbuild@3.0.1(typescript@5.4.2)(vue-tsc@2.1.10(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2)): + unbuild@3.0.1(typescript@5.4.2)(vue-tsc@2.2.0(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2)): dependencies: '@rollup/plugin-alias': 5.1.1(rollup@4.28.1) '@rollup/plugin-commonjs': 28.0.1(rollup@4.28.1) @@ -8404,7 +8404,7 @@ snapshots: hookable: 5.5.3 jiti: 2.4.2 magic-string: 0.30.15 - mkdist: 2.0.1(typescript@5.4.2)(vue-tsc@2.1.10(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2)) + mkdist: 2.0.1(typescript@5.4.2)(vue-tsc@2.2.0(typescript@5.4.2))(vue@3.5.13(typescript@5.4.2)) mlly: 1.7.3 pathe: 1.1.2 pkg-types: 1.2.1 @@ -8667,7 +8667,7 @@ snapshots: - supports-color - terser - vite-plugin-checker@0.8.0(eslint@9.17.0(jiti@2.4.2))(optionator@0.9.3)(typescript@5.4.2)(vite@5.4.11(@types/node@22.10.2)(terser@5.29.2))(vue-tsc@2.1.10(typescript@5.4.2)): + vite-plugin-checker@0.8.0(eslint@9.17.0(jiti@2.4.2))(optionator@0.9.3)(typescript@5.4.2)(vite@5.4.11(@types/node@22.10.2)(terser@5.29.2))(vue-tsc@2.2.0(typescript@5.4.2)): dependencies: '@babel/code-frame': 7.26.2 ansi-escapes: 4.3.2 @@ -8688,7 +8688,7 @@ snapshots: eslint: 9.17.0(jiti@2.4.2) optionator: 0.9.3 typescript: 5.4.2 - vue-tsc: 2.1.10(typescript@5.4.2) + vue-tsc: 2.2.0(typescript@5.4.2) vite-plugin-inspect@0.8.7(@nuxt/kit@3.14.1592(magicast@0.3.5)(rollup@4.28.1))(rollup@4.28.1)(vite@5.4.11(@types/node@22.10.2)(terser@5.29.2)): dependencies: @@ -8842,11 +8842,10 @@ snapshots: '@vue/devtools-api': 6.6.4 vue: 3.5.13(typescript@5.4.2) - vue-tsc@2.1.10(typescript@5.4.2): + vue-tsc@2.2.0(typescript@5.4.2): dependencies: - '@volar/typescript': 2.4.8 - '@vue/language-core': 2.1.10(typescript@5.4.2) - semver: 7.6.3 + '@volar/typescript': 2.4.11 + '@vue/language-core': 2.2.0(typescript@5.4.2) typescript: 5.4.2 vue@3.5.13(typescript@5.4.2):